dc.description.abstractIn metrology, high demands are placed on accurate and sensitive measuring equipment. The aim of this project was to design and implement a highly accurate and sensitive device for the measurement of relative humidity in ambient gas with an absolute measurement error of less than 1 %, which can be used in numerous branches (food packing, health care, pharmacy, logging industry, labs etc.).en
